How Long Should Recovering from Drug and Alcohol Addiction Take?
Depending on the kind of addiction and severity, you or someone close to you may need anything from a one month in-patient drug or alcohol rehab facility all the way up to a longer-term one. Other drugs may allow for outpatient programs while severe cases may necessitate long-term treatment services. However, you can find a Monroe treatment facility to fit just about any budget.
